In Lloyd's mirror a few fringes on one side of the central fringe are observed, the central fringe being itself invisible. 2) The biprism the central fringe is bright whereas in case of Lloyd's mirror, it is dark. 3) The central fringe is less sharp in biprism than that in Lloyd's mirror. Web4.11 FRESNEL'S BIPRISM. Fresnel produced the interference fringes in the laboratory by deriving two coherent sources S 1 and S 2 from a single monochromatic source S by using the deviation produced by a biprism. The experimental arrangement is shown schematically in Figure 7. The biprism consists of two acute angled prisms with their bases in ...
